Get started21 Parkside Place is a one-bedroom mid-terrace house in Cambridge (CB1 1HQ). It has a recorded floor area of 57 m² (around 614 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2012 onwards and council tax band D. The latest certificate (February 2023) returns a B (score 82), comfortably above the UK average. When first surveyed in April 2013 the rating was C,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. At 57 m² this is the 6th smallest of 30 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 47–194 m². The building's EPC ratings span C to B, with this unit at the top. Other recorded features include a balcony and notable views.
At 57 m² it sits well below the postcode median (82 m² across 29 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 79% of similar EPCs). Last sold in August 2013, so it's been off the market for around 13 years. Today's modelled estimate of £382,000 is 31.7% above the 2013 sale price.
